ALEXANDRIA, Va., July 15 -- United States Patent no. 12,663,197, issued on June 23, was assigned to ELECTROLUX APPLIANCES AKTIEBOLAG (Stockholm).

"Refrigerator with a variable speed compressor and a method for controlling the compressor speed" was invented by Tommaso Pellegrini (Porcia, Italy), Mario Vargas (Stockholm) and Augusto Buosi (Porcia, Italy).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Refrigerator (200, 210) comprising a compartment (13a) for storing foodstuff; a cooling system (200, 210) comprising an evaporator (12a), a condenser (14) and a variable speed compressor (10), the cooling system (200, 210) being adapted to go through a refrigeration cycle at certain intervals.
